In a car, I prefer to use a .12; the smaller engines will give you more power in the upper rpm range where you run most of the time. I’m sure others may have different opinions.
Try looking at the .12 OS CV-R. This engine is a true runner that has driven many a car to the checkered flag. Easy to tune and help is always available.
The .12 Fantom FR12 is a screaming meanie, it tops out at 43,000 rpm and will kick some a ss. It’s a bit more finicky to tune but once you get it figured out you will love it.
